Improves Energy Efficiency

By flushing your water heater, you’ll remove sediment buildup that reduces energy efficiency, ensuring it operates at peak performance.

Sediment, primarily composed of calcium carbonate and other minerals, accumulates at the tank’s bottom. This layer of sediment acts as an insulator, forcing your heating elements to work harder, thereby consuming more energy. To avoid accidents, turn off the power supply or gas valve to flush your water heater. Connect a garden hose to the drain valve, directing the other end to a suitable drainage area.

Open the valve, allowing the tank to empty. Be mindful of the hot water to prevent burns. Once drained, close the valve and refill the tank, restoring power or gas supply.

This simple procedure can reduce energy consumption by up to 15% when performed annually.

Minimizes Noise Levels

Sediment build-up in your water heater often causes rumbling or popping noises, which you can minimize by conducting an annual flush to clear out debris and maintain smooth operation.

This sediment consists of minerals like calcium and magnesium, which settle at the bottom of the tank over time. When the heater operates, these deposits can create air pockets, leading to the unsettling noises you might hear.

By performing regular flushes, you reduce these disruptions, guaranteeing a quieter environment for your household or workplace.

Here are some practical steps to achieve noise reduction through flushing:

  • Turn off the power supply: Confirm your water heater is off to prevent accidents.
  • Connect a garden hose to the drain valve for efficient sediment removal.
  • Open the drain valve: Allow the water to flow, taking sediment.
  • Flush with cold water: Rinse the tank until the water runs clear.
  • Inspect the anode rod: Check for corrosion and replace if necessary to prevent further sediment build-up.

Frequently Asked Questions

How Often Should a Water Heater Be Flushed for Optimal Performance?

For ideal performance, flush your water heater annually. This prevents sediment buildup, ensuring efficiency and longevity. If you’ve got hard water, consider semi-annual flushing. It’s a proactive step to maintain consistent service for your clients.
